Signature Patterns
- •Focus on structured reading challenges and progress tracking
- •B2B2C distribution model via school and library partnerships
- •Privacy-first approach with no ads or data sales
- •Integration with institutional SSO systems

The Analyst's Read
The bottom line on Zoobean
Bottom line
Zoobean is a specialized publisher with a strong foothold in the educational sector, leveraging institutional partnerships to drive user adoption. Their high-frequency update cadence and consistent user ratings reflect a stable, utility-driven product-market fit.
